Output 51bbd316bfa89054f8e42dbd61b8ee47581d48ba1b282c1482f761a842246135:0

value
2220448626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38837ca0a8d3e57b549a70dbb4e7b662407d9038 OP_EQUALVERIFY OP_CHECKSIG
address
FaKXoWxZYtRDgNqQNMXMeE1b5VxD5P7kLm
transaction
51bbd316bfa89054f8e42dbd61b8ee47581d48ba1b282c1482f761a842246135